SEBASTIAN BACH (ex-SKID ROW) will release his new album, Kicking & Screaming, on September 27 via Frontiers Records.

The album was produced by Bob Marlette, and mastered at Precision Mastering in Los Angeles with Tom Baker. Kicking & Screaming features guitarist Nick Sterling and drummer Bobby Jarzombek (HALFORD, RIOT, ICED EARTH). Check out the album artwork below:

Noisecreep recently issued an interview with Bach, conducted by Karen Bliss. An excerpt follows:

Q: So this is Sebastian Bach having three kids and going through a divorce?

A: "Well, a lot of the songs on this record are to do with breaking up. (Guitarist) Nick (Sterling) broke up with a girl and was heart broken and he's showing me a lot of these lyrics and I was divorcing and then there's a song about finding new love too. It's hard for me to do this interview without me giving you song titles. I'm lucky enough to have found a new girl that I love and there are a couple of songs that have to do with that. You know, most of the best rock 'n' roll songs are about chicks [laughs]."

As previously reported, Bach will be filming some episodes of an online series called Adults Only, featuring Vincent Pastore (Sopranos) this week in Boston. Baz plays the role of Shifty and is busy memorizing lines.

Adults Only rating: PG-13

Kenny Rioux used to be a huge child star, appearing on the iconic '80s sitcom Married To The Family, but times change and stars fall. Now down on his luck and unable to find work as an actor, Kenny must accept a job managing his brother-in-law’s adult video/novelty store in order to make ends meet, all while trying to conceal his identity from the public, particularly a new love interest who serves as the trigger in his reinvention of self.
